Try this delicious Couscous Black Bean Bowl with Enchilada Sauce & Red Pepper – a wholesome, protein-packed meal full of fiber, flavor, and nutrients. Perfect for a quick, healthy lunch or dinner!

restaurant_menu Yields: 1 Serving
Cooking Time: 60 minutes
Ingredients
  1. 1 cup couscous
  2. 1 cup boiling water (or vegetable broth for extra flavor)
  3. 2 tbsp fresh cilantro, chopped
  4. 1 tbsp olive oil
  5. 1 cup enchilada sauce (store-bought or homemade)
  6. 1/2 tsp smoked paprika
  7. Salt & pepper to taste
  8. 1/2 tsp cumin powder
  9. 1 tbsp olive oil
  10. 1 red bell pepper, thinly sliced
  11. 1 cup cooked black beans (or canned, rinsed & drained)
Instruction
  1. Cook couscous – In a bowl, add couscous and boiling water (or broth). Cover with a lid or plate and let sit for 5 minutes. Fluff with a fork.
  2. Prepare veggies – Heat olive oil in a skillet. Sauté red bell pepper until slightly softened. Add cumin, smoked paprika, salt, and pepper.
  3. Add beans – Stir in black beans. Cook for 2–3 minutes until warmed through.
  4. Combine with couscous – Add the sautéed veggies and beans to the couscous. Mix gently.
  5. Top with enchilada sauce – Pour enchilada sauce over the couscous mixture and stir lightly to coat
  6. Garnish & serve – Sprinkle with fresh cilantro, a squeeze of lime juice, and any optional toppings.
